2025年9月25日: PostgreSQL 18 釋出!
支援的版本: 當前 (18) / 17 / 16 / 15 / 14 / 13
開發版本: devel
不支援的版本: 12 / 11 / 10 / 9.6 / 9.5 / 9.4 / 9.3 / 9.2 / 9.1 / 9.0 / 8.4 / 8.3 / 8.2 / 8.1 / 8.0 / 7.4

35.20. data_type_privileges #

檢視 data_type_privileges 標識當前使用者有權訪問的所有資料型別描述符,透過擁有被描述物件的所有權或對其擁有某種許可權。每當資料型別用於表列、域或函式的定義(作為引數或返回型別)時,都會生成一個數據型別描述符,並存儲有關該資料型別在該例項中如何使用的某些資訊(例如,適用的情況下,宣告的最大長度)。每個資料型別描述符都被分配一個任意識別符號,該識別符號在一個物件的(表、域、函式)分配的資料型別描述符識別符號中是唯一的。此檢視可能對應用程式沒有用,但它用於定義資訊模式中的一些其他檢視。

表 35.18. data_type_privileges

列 型別

描述

object_catalog sql_identifier

包含被描述物件的資料庫名稱(始終是當前資料庫)

object_schema sql_identifier

包含被描述物件的模式名稱

object_name sql_identifier

被描述物件的名稱

object_type character_data

被描述物件的型別:可以是 TABLE(資料型別描述符與該表的列相關)、DOMAIN(資料型別描述符與該域相關)、ROUTINE(資料型別描述符與該函式的引數或返回資料型別相關)。

dtd_identifier sql_identifier

資料型別描述符的識別符號,該識別符號在同一物件的資料型別描述符中是唯一的。


提交更正

如果您在文件中發現任何不正確之處、與您在使用特定功能時的體驗不符之處或需要進一步澄清之處,請使用此表格報告文件問題。